var dotenv = require('dotenv').config();
var fs = require('fs');
var jsforce = require('jsforce');
// let mkdirp = require('mkdirp');
const LOGIN_URL = process.env.LOGINURL;
const SFDC_USERNAME = process.env.SFDC_USERNAME;
const SFDC_PASSWORD = process.env.SFDC_PASSWORD;
const SFDC_API_VER = process.env.SFDC_API_VER;
const SFDC_QUERY = process.env.QUERY;
const LOGS_DIR = process.env.DIRECTORY;
console.log('SFDC_USERNAME: '+SFDC_USERNAME);
console.log('LOGIN_URL: '+LOGIN_URL);
console.log('SFDC_QUERY: '+SFDC_QUERY);
console.log('LOGS_DIR: '+LOGS_DIR);
console.log('SFDC_API_VER: '+SFDC_API_VER);
var conn = new jsforce.Connection({
// you can change loginUrl to connect to sandbox or prerelease env.
loginUrl : LOGIN_URL
});
conn.login(SFDC_USERNAME, SFDC_PASSWORD, function(err, userInfo) {
if (err) { return console.error(err); }
// Now you can get the access token and instance URL information.
// Save them to establish connection next time.
// console.log(conn.accessToken);
console.log('SFDC Instance URL: ', conn.instanceUrl);
// logged in user property
console.log("Org ID: " + userInfo.organizationId);
console.log("User ID: " + userInfo.id);
getRecords(conn);
});
/**
* This method will query the ApexLogs records.
* @param {Object} conn
*/
let getRecords = (conn) => {
conn.query(SFDC_QUERY, function(err, result) {
if (err) { return console.error(err); }
console.log("total : " + result.totalSize);
console.log("fetched : " + result.records.length);
for(let rec of result.records) {
// console.log(rec);
getLog(conn, rec);
}
});
}
/**
* This method will get the ApexLog Log raw data
* @param {Object} conn
* @param {Object} logRec
*/
let getLog = (conn, logRec) => {
let url = "/services/data/v" + SFDC_API_VER + "/tooling/sobjects/ApexLog/" + logRec.Id + "/Body/";
console.log(url);
conn.request({
method: 'GET',
url: url,
headers: {
'content-type': 'application/json',
},
}).then(resp => {
//console.log(response);
writeToFile(logRec, resp, 'log'); // writing log data to the file
writeToFile(logRec, logRec, ''); // writing ApexLog details to the JSON file
});
}
/**
* to get the Current date
*/
let getTodayDate = () => {
const today = new Date();
return ((today.getMonth()+1)+'-'+today.getDate()+'-'+today.getFullYear());
}
let dir = LOGS_DIR+SFDC_USERNAME+'-logs/'+getTodayDate()+'/';
console.log('Logs path: ', dir);
/**
* This method will write log data to the file
* @param {object} logRec
* @param {rawData} data
* @param {String} type
*/
const writeToFile = (logRec, data, type) => {
let dateStamp = logRec.StartTime;
// To replace : character with . in the date stamp
while(dateStamp.includes(':')) {
dateStamp = dateStamp.replace(':','.');
}
let filePath = './'+dir+'/'+logRec.Id+dateStamp;
// Appending extension .log/.json to the file name
if(type === 'log') {
filePath += '.log';
} else {
filePath += '.json';
data = JSON.stringify(data, null, 2);
}
// Writing data to the file
fs.writeFile(filePath, data, function (err) {
if (err) return console.log(err);
console.log('File Name: '+filePath);
});
}
/**
* This method will create the path
* @param {String} dirPath
*/
const createDir = (dirPath) => {
fs.mkdirSync(process.cwd()+dirPath, {recursive : true}, (err) => {
if(err) {
console.log('Error creating '+dirPath+' : '+err);
} else {
console.log(dirPath+' path created successfully.');
}
});
}
if(!fs.existsSync(dir)) {
createDir(dir);
}
